brakence, hypochondriac [📷: Columbia]“How this shit ain’t obvious to you? I’m not even twenty-one.” Damn, 🎙 brakence has no shortage of confidence.  Of course, since recording 🎵 “caffeine” and releasing 💿 hypochondriac (December 2, 2022), the handsome 🤩 and talented Randall Findell has officially turned 21.  The fact that he’s aged does not take away from “caffeine,” where he paints himself as a badass – cocky, confident, trash-talking, etc.  The chorus continues, “My music be the snobbiest, somehow I’m still gon’ get it done / And I ain’t do this for the audience, hold me down, I already won / I know I’m dope as fuck, I guess I’m glowin’ up.” Woo!

Besides a lit chorus, brakence is backed by electrifying production.  The sound is true to the hyperpop/ experimental realm – very different from mainstream pop.  Also, “caffeine” shares some hip-hop sensibilities, yet, can’t be solely characterized as hip-hop. Beyond the chorus, there is no shortage of brakence feeling himself, with no shortage of profanity, mind you.  “It’s all personal / If I fuck with your shit, you better take it personal,” he asserts in the first beat, continuing, “I’m murderin’ any beat you send me ‘cause I’m versatile / But if I ain’t like your shit, then you won’t get a verse at all.” Oh, snap 🫰!
